      System Management-A key to System Stability  
 
 

In a traditional small and medium business, MIS management is done thru a MIS personal going to individual computer system to check on the hardware and/or software. This way of operating is acceptable for smaller companies, but if applied to a big enterprise, this way will be very expensive and inefficient. For present operation, the server system plays a very critical role for MIS management. With the popularity of internet, servers are no longer is used only for data-sharing and database. They are also used for e-commerce and international sales functions.

Importance of System Management

The traditional way of system maintenance is very time-consuming and inefficient. MIS personnel must first understand the system they are dealing with and then learn how to properly correct the problem found either in the hardware or software. If they need to update or fix the system, personnel will need to open up the system, understand the hardware they are dealing with, find the correct component, replace the parts need changing, and then close up the system.

The advantages ASUS System Monitoring Agent (ASMA) and ASUS System Web-Based Management (ASWM) offer to our clients are systems that omit all the "running-around." With a click of your mouse, our systems present all the important data front of you in seconds. It is quick, easy, and informative.
 

ASUS's Development in Hardware

Asus has developed a chipset that monitors the hardware system. This chipset is mounted on our server motherboard or available thru PCI add-on card. When selling the whole system, our next generation server will support IPMI1.5 technology.

ASUS's Development in Software

With a world-leading Research and Development team, ASMA and ASWM system management software is completely developed by ASUS. ASMA acts as an agent for system management interface. It collects data from the hardware and transfers it to the SNMP protocol. MIS can install software that can read SNMP protocol to retrieve and read the data it gets from this protocol. ASWM with HTTP protocol to allows users to manage the system thru browser for an easy-to-use user experience.

The advantages of ASMA+ASWM

1. Convenience: Web-based
When you buy a server from ASUS, you can use web browser to view the systems that are located elsewhere. You don't have to go through a lot of procedures to install an application. ASWM provides a very friendly user interface by using pictures and icons, so you can read the information easily.
2. Informative: provides all the information you need
In the section of "System Summary", you can see the whole interior of the system, down to the location of each component. In the "Health" section, shows the temperature and voltage of components; speed and numbers of system fans, and devices' capacity.
The "Inventory FRU Information" section also displays the name and part number of each component.
3. Automatic Update
ASWM can automatically updates data every 5 seconds, saving you the time of reloading the data. A "Real Time Chart" function administrator can run the update for periodically to discover the highs and lows of a particular monitored component.
4. Warning Functions
When there is a data over threshold, ASMA will send a trap. You will see a warning or critical sign in ASWM. The administrator will also get an alert-email when errors occur.
5. Remote Control
The VNC (Virtual Network Computing) Client allows you to control servers remotely. You can turn off, reset, login in, login out, and edit the files and many other things remotely.
6. OS support
ASMA supports Windows 2000, Windows NT, Linux, and Netware, while ASWM supports Windows 2000, Windows NT and Linux.
